What This Means in Plain English

RIVERSIDE CARE CENTER receives an overall staffing grade of A (Very Good). With 4.7013 total nurse hours per resident per day, this facility meets the CMS staffing benchmark and has adequate registered nurse (RN) coverage. It is 0.81 HPRD above the national average.

Weekend staffing decreases noticeably — dropping 20.44% compared to weekdays. The facility has low agency staff usage (0% of hours), suggesting a mostly permanent workforce.

Staffing levels have remained relatively stable over recent quarters.
